Transaction 8fee97eb406f86f3797287023096562856a87aa331d5585fc7f7b6ae21aa64f2
1 Input
1 Output
-
8fee97eb406f86f3797287023096562856a87aa331d5585fc7f7b6ae21aa64f2:0
- value
- 680529
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d692d5a405cc3fd69a785484c8187fa26910ddc9 OP_EQUAL
- address
- 3MFaRqYRvM7nkL5eZB9j1H7ScqadXmoV5q